All five No. 1 teams remain same in latest girls basketball rankings

All five No. 1 ranked teams remained in that spot in the latest girls basketball polls from the Iowa Girls High School Athletic Union.
Johnston (Class 5A), Sioux City Bishop Heelan (4A), Mount Vernon (3A), Eddyville-Blakesburg-Fremont (2A) and Council Bluffs St. Albert (1A) will enter February as No. 1s.
Newcomers to the polls include Burlington (4A), ACGC (3A), Sigourney (1A), Lenox (1A) and Riverside (1A).
